How to protect your complexion
You need to protect your complexion from the sun. Exposure to the sun can cause a tan which makes your face look dull and lifeless. It can also cause age spots and premature aging. Even in winter you need to protect yourself from the sun. What happens in winter is due to the extreme cold we tend to want to expose our skin to the slightest hope of the sun. Since we are unaware of the intensity of the sun due to the extreme cold we are not aware when the sun burns our skin and the after effects of this exposure.
Go not use soap on your facial skin very often as soap will dry your skin and make it look dull. Use a face wash instead; one that suits your skin type and will moisturize your skin while cleaning it at the same time.
You need to get rid of the dead skin cells on your face as well as clean your pores. To do this use an exfoliating face scrub. Use an almond or walnut based scrub for best results. You can use a cosmetic product or choose to make one at home.
Quit habits like smoking and alcohol. If you smoke you release hot smoke directly onto your face and this leads to wrinkles and fine lines around your eyes. Alcohol makes your eyes look puffy and swollen.
Sleep for at least 6 hours daily. The amount of undisturbed sleep you get reflects daily on your complexion. Lack of sleep results in puffy eyes and dark circles.
